
Performance and Software
Under the hood, the Lenovo K6 Power is powered by the Qualcomm Snapdragon 430 chipset, integrating an octa-core 1.4 GHz Cortex-A53 processor and an Adreno 505 GPU. This setup provides decent performance for day-to-day operations and some casual gaming. Initially shipped with Android 6.0 (Marshmallow), the device is upgradable to Android 7.0 (Nougat), giving users access to more recent features and improved user experience. Storage options include either 16GB with 2GB RAM or 32GB with 3GB RAM, both utilizing eMMC 5.1 for better data management, and there is a provision to expand storage via a microSD card using the shared SIM slot.
